About the Item

This exquisite secretary, crafted from rich mahogany with intricate inlaid wood details, showcases the elegance and craftsmanship of the 1840s. With its timeless design and impeccable antique condition, this piece exudes sophistication and charm. The secretary features a classic silhouette with delicate carvings and ornate accents, reflecting the opulence of the Empire style. Its sturdy construction and meticulous attention to detail speak to the skill of the craftsmen who created it, making it a true work of art. Designed to provide both beauty and functionality, this secretary offers ample storage space with its drawers, compartments, and writing surface. Whether used as a decorative accent or as a functional piece of furniture, it adds a touch of old-world elegance to any interior space.
